Igarashi Hiroyuki, known to most as EXILE HIRO, is the founder, and former dancer and leader of JPOP groups J Soul Brothers and EXILE.

In 2003, he founded the management agency LDH (Love Dream Happiness). In 2013, he retired as a dancer and focused on producing music and movies for the artists under LDH. Eventually, Hiro retired as the president of LDH and became the CCO and chairman instead.

After Japan won their bid for the Olympics, Hiro was selected as a member of the Tokyo 2020 Culture and Education Commission. He was also awarded the Commissioner for Cultural Affairs Award by the Japanese Government's Agency for Cultural Affairs for his contribution to Japan's artistic culture. Tokyo Organizing Committee of the Olympic and Paralympic Games appointed Hiro as the director of the Tokyo 2020 cultural segment of the Olympic Flame Handover Ceremony. The committee also chose Hiro to advocate and improve awareness for the Paralympic athletes.

Hiro and actress Ueto Aya got married in September 2012. Their first daughter was born on August 19, 2015. On July 27, 2019, the birth of their second child, a boy, was announced. On June 23, 2023, the birth of their third child, a boy, was announced.

On September 25, 2023, it was announced that he would return as representative director and president of LDH JAPAN.
